# webpack_ts_demo **Repository Path**: dys6230/webpack_ts_demo ## Basic Information - **Project Name**: webpack_ts_demo - **Description**: Webpack 5 + TypeScript + SCSS + UnoCSS 环境 - **Primary Language**: JavaScript -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 1 - **Forks**: 0 - **Created**: 2024-08-24 - **Last Updated**: 2024-09-04 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# webpack_ts_demo #### 介绍 Webpack 5 + TypeScript + SCSS + UnoCSS 环境 #### 软件架构 软件架构说明 配置 Loaders 用于处理项目中的不同类型文件。 JavaScript/TypeScript Loader 安装 Babel Loader 或 TypeScript Loader: 可以处理sass 支持typescript语法 处理图片和字体 加入HtmlWebpackPlugin和CleanWebpackPlugin插件 配置 resolve.alias 设置 mode 以区分开发和生产环境: 打包优化:配置压缩、分离 CSS 等优化措施: 配置 ES Modules 支持 配置完成后给我所有的配置文件完整的代码 #### 安装教程 1. yarn 或者 pnpm install #### 使用说明 1. 启动: yarn start 或者 pnpm run start 2. 打包: yarn build 或者 pnpm run build #### 参与贡献 dys6230 #### 参考 https://webpack.docschina.org/concepts/